Formula Racing : Top Honda personnel attending Austrian GP – but what does it mean? – The Race

Formula Racing : Top Honda personnel attending Austrian GP – but what does it mean? – The Race

Formula Racing : Top Honda personnel attending Austrian GP – but what does it mean? – The Race

Formula Racing News

Top Honda personnel attending Austrian GP – but what does it mean?  The Race

[Relative Post]

Similar Posts